I don't know how much they cost, but Sram makes bar-end shifters compatible with their road groups...
http://www.sram.com/sram/road/category/non_series

(looked it up and the TT500 shifters are $120 on niagaracycle.com)

Could be a reasonable back-up bit of equipment to keep on hand. Unfortunately, I don't think the Sram bar end shifters have a 'friction' option like SHimano ones do.

On that note, Shimano bar end shifters would also work in friction mode, as well as Rivendell 'Silver' friction shifters, and old-school bar-cons you might be able to find on e-Pay.
